Beyond the Cheese Board: The Anatomy of a Perfect Hamper
While cheese is often the centerpiece—and for good reason—restricting your search to "cheese hampers" is like asking for an opera and only being shown the violins. A truly exceptional hamper needs depth, textural contrast, and a thoughtful pairing narrative. Think of it as building a perfect meal, not just collecting snacks.
Here’s what professional curators look for when assembling a memorable spread:
- The Star Player (Cheese): Select 2-3 cheeses that offer variety in texture and flavor profile—something soft and bloomy (like a Brie), something hard and nutty (like an Aged Gouda), and maybe a creamy, earthy blue.
- The Supporting Cast (Charcuterie & Meat): The cured meats should provide saltiness and richness to cut through the creaminess of the cheese. Look for artisan salamis or prosciutto that are dry-cured, not just smoked.
- The Texture Bridge (Carriers): This is where most generic hampers fail. You need something crunchy and something chewy. Pairing a soft cheese with a flaky baguette is classic; pairing it with water crackers and toasted nuts adds necessary structural variety.
- The Sweet Counterpoint: Don't forget the jam, honey, or fig spread. The sweetness must be robust enough to stand up to salty meats.

The Hidden Luxury: Focus on Pairing and Narrative
The biggest step up from a basic gift set is adding narrative. A truly luxurious hamper doesn't just contain items; it tells a story. It suggests an occasion: "This board is perfect for a rainy Saturday afternoon with a good glass of Cabernet."
Consider these pairing principles when you are browsing online selections:
- Sweet vs. Salty: If the cheese selection is particularly salty or sharp, ensure there is a sweet element (like honeycomb) to balance the palate.
- Soft vs. Hard: Pairing a creamy, soft goat cheese with a crisp, aged Manchego creates an immediate textural conversation that elevates the whole experience.
- The Complementary Accent: Adding small, high-quality elements like gourmet cornichons, spiced candied walnuts, or smoked paprika enhances the visual appeal and provides necessary acidic pops of flavor.

Mastering the Delivery Experience
When ordering online, pay close attention to the fulfillment details. Luxury items require specialized care. Does the vendor guarantee proper temperature control? Is there a clear plan for delivery that ensures the cheese remains cool until it reaches the doorstep? A reputable seller will make this process transparent; you shouldn't have to ask three times just to confirm they ship ice packs.
